Arsenal send club physio to Ghana with Thomas Partey in desperate bid to ensure key midfielder avoids injury on international duty so he can stay fit for Premier League title race

Arsenal have sent the club physio to Ghana with Thomas Partey in a desperate bid to ensure the key midfielder avoids injury on international duty.

The Gunners moved eight points clear of Manchester City with a 4-1 victory over Crystal Palace on Saturday, albeit the reigning champions have a game in hand.

The victory over Palace was the Gunner's final game before the international break.

The Ghana star, 29, is expected to face Angola in back-to-back matches on March 23 and 27 as qualifying for the African Cup of Nations continues.
